The Science Behind McDonald's Jam

Ever wondered what makes McDonald's jam so... well, McDonald's-y? It's not just the taste, but the texture, the spreadability, the way it melts into your mouth. All this is a result of some serious science.

McDonald's jam is made using a process called 'gelification'. Fruits are cooked with pectin (a natural thickening agent) and sugar until they reach a specific temperature. This causes the pectin to gel, giving McDonald's jam its unique spreadable consistency. The sugar also acts as a preservative, helping McDonald's jam stay fresh for longer.
